time vulnerable to stack exhaustion Denial of Service attack

When user-provided input is provided to any type that parses with the RFC 2822 format, a Denial of Service attack via stack exhaustion is possible. The attack relies on formally deprecated and rarely-used features that are part of the RFC 2822 format used in a malicious manner. Ordinary, non-malicious input will never encounter this scenario.

Segmentation fault in time

Unix-like operating systems may segfault due to dereferencing a dangling pointer in specific circumstances. This requires an environment variable to be set in a different thread than the affected functions. This may occur without the user's knowledge, notably in a third-party library.
